    Marine Program Intern

    WHAT WE CAN ACHIEVE TOGETHER

    Our aim is to conserve and restore lost or degraded coastal wetlands (seagrass meadows, mangroves, and salt marshes) and promote best practices to scale beyond the capacity of TNC. The current geographic focus of TNC Africa Oceans Strategy is Seychelles, Kenya, Tanzania, South Africa, Gabon, Namibia, Angola, and Mauritius. The focus of this program is coastal Kenya with most functions in the South Coast and Lamu-Tana seascape.
